Order service:
1-888-727-6368
|
USA
▼
USA
Canada
Australia
United Kingdom
China
|
Help
|
LearningCenter
|
Feedback
|
Register
SignIn
Location:
Home
>
YellowPages
>
NY
>
Lodi
> Terabyte Technical Services
Terabyte Technical Services
8521 Upper Lake Rd
Lodi, NY 14860
607-582-7400
Category
COMPUTERS SVCS